Spotter Training Calendar - NWS Gaylord

 

Below is the calendar of spotter training classes scheduled across northern Michigan.  If you are unable to make it to a training class or would like a refresher on weather spotter principles, there are several on-line storm spotter training modules and reference materials available:

Do you have questions about SKYWARN or becoming a spotter?  Click here for our SKYWARN FAQ page.  Most sessions are open to the general public with no need to pre-register.  All training is free and usually lasts around 1.5 hours.
